Upon hatching, the plumage of the duckling is yellow on the underside and face (with streaks by the eyes) and black on the back (with some yellow spots) all the way to the top and back of the head. The mallard was one of the many bird species originally described by Carl Linnaeus in his 18th-century work Systema Naturae, and still bears its original binomial name. The scientific name is from Latin Anas, "duck" and Ancient Greek platyrhynchus , "broad-billed" ( from platus, "broad" and rhunkhos, " bill"). Both male and female mallards have distinct iridescent purple-blue speculum feathers edged with white, which are prominent in flight or at rest but temporarily shed during the annual summer moult. It was derived from the Old French malart or mallart for "wild drake", although its true derivation is unclear.
